Transcendental Meditation: A Path to Serenity

Meditation

Transcendental Meditation, often referred to as TM, is a technique that involves sitting comfortably with closed eyes and silently repeating a mantra. This simple yet profound practice allows the mind to settle inward beyond thought to experience pure awareness.

Research has shown that practicing Transcendental Meditation can lead to reduced stress, improved clarity of mind, increased creativity, and enhanced overall well-being. Many people who incorporate TM into their daily routine report feeling more relaxed, focused, and in tune with themselves.

Other Mind-Calming Techniques to Try

  • Deep Breathing: Take slow, deep breaths to calm your nervous system and center your mind.
  • Yoga: Combine movement with breath to promote relaxation and mental clarity.
  • Nature Walks: Immerse yourself in the beauty of nature to soothe your mind and lift your spirits.
  • Journaling: Write down your thoughts and feelings to release mental clutter and gain insights into your emotions.
  • Listening to Music: Choose calming music that resonates with you to create a peaceful atmosphere.
